What We Know — and How This Pack Is Built

The AD5 2026 competition is the first to include a Digital Skills test, so no preparation material — including this one — can guarantee it matches the exact format or difficulty of what EPSO will use. What is stated in the Notice of Competition is that the test is grounded in DigComp 2.2. That framework is the basis for everything here.

The questions are written as applied workplace scenarios — not IT trivia — and are intentionally demanding. Many go beyond basic digital literacy. The goal is to prepare you for a harder version of the test than you will likely face, so that on the day, nothing feels unfamiliar. The pack covers all five DigComp 2.2 competence areas: Information & Data Literacy, Communication & Collaboration, Digital Content Creation, Safety, and Problem Solving.
